Dying Light “Major Project” in the Works, Explores Game From “Totally New Angle”

Gamescom will see the first reveal of this new content.

Dying Light

Techland is teasing a new project for Dying Light, it’s open world zombie survival horror title that saw massive success and tons of updates since its launch earlier this year. A new video was released that detailed the various updates and content drops that Dying Light has seen so far this year, but what’s more interesting is the new “major project”.

Producer Tymon Smektala stated that, “We’re really excited to finally be able to show this major project we’ve been secretly working on since the release of the game. This is Dying Light from totally new angle, but with everything fans love about the original still at the core.

Expect a reveal of the content – which looks to be a major expansion – at Gamescom 2015. It will be showcased to the world shortly thereafter.

Dying Light released to above average reviews earlier this year but was a strong financial success for developer Techland with millions of players at launch. We’ll see how the new content fits into the base game in the coming weeks.
